Merge branch 'feature/refactor-install-script-generation-edit' into 'master'

feature/add-extract-module-python-script

Closes #1037 and #1021

See merge request !2709

(cherry picked from commit 559fcc21)

7ea7a7c1 [bin][util][common] Make util a package and write basic functions into common.py
ceaa8d30 [bin][util][moduleinfo] Rename script of dune-module information
7b653245 [bin][util]->[bin] Reconstrcut folder (move scripts to bin) and adapt imports
8d8ec200 [bin][util][writer] Add script to write install scirpt in different languages
3c4dd414 [bin][util][installscript] Add script to write helper function to make install script
7fe619e6 [bin] Rename, move and improve make_installscript, which is used to make an install script
993abbcc [bin][extractModule] Delete shell and provide new extract module script
5 jobs for !2751 with cherry-pick-559fcc21
latest detached
Status Name Job ID Coverage
  Trigger
manual full-dune-2.7-clang
manual full-dune-2.7-gcc
manual full-dune-master-gcc
manual minimal-dune-2.7-gcc
 
  Downstream Modules
created trigger lecture